STEADY RAINFALL MAY LEAD TO FLOODING SUNDAY
Cook County, IL Ford County, IL Grundy County, IL Iroquois County, IL Kankakee County, IL Kendall County, IL LaSalle County, IL Livingston County, IL Will County, IL Benton County, IN Jasper County, IN Lake County, IN Newton County, IN Porter County, IN
ESFLOT
A steady soaking rain is expected Sunday afternoon and evening. The
highest rainfall amounts are forecast south of I-80 where totals in
excess of 2 inches are possible.
Many rivers and streams across the region remain elevated from
recent heavy rainfall. Thus, rainfall amounts of this magnitude will
result in renewed rises on area streams and rivers, with some
potentially topping flood stage.
Uncertainty remains with where the heaviest rainfall amounts will
occur. Anyone in or near flood prone areas should thus closely
monitor later forecasts.
This outlook will be updated by this evening.
